Tell me about Wonder Woman 1984 full story.
1 answer
2024-12-02 15:47
In the full story of 'Wonder Woman 1984', the plot unfolds in a very interesting way. Diana is living her life in 1984 when Maxwell Lord, a power - hungry character, discovers a stone that can grant wishes. This causes a chain reaction as people start making all kinds of wishes. Barbara, who is an archaeologist, makes a wish to be more like Diana. This wish turns her into the Cheetah, a formidable adversary. Diana, on the other hand, wishes for Steve Trevor to return. But his return is not without problems as he is in someone else's body. As the world around them starts to crumble due to the chaotic wishes, Diana has to find a way to stop Maxwell Lord and reverse the damage. She has to use her strength, wisdom and the lasso of truth to save the world from the impending doom that these wishes have brought upon it.
What are the key elements in Wonder Woman 1984 full story?
1 answer
2024-11-30 08:21
The key elements in the full story of 'Wonder Woman 1984' are quite diverse. Firstly, the setting in the 1980s gives a unique backdrop. The wish - granting stone that Maxwell Lord uses is central as it drives the plot forward. It leads to the chaos that ensues as people make self - serving wishes. Barbara Minerva's journey from an ordinary archaeologist to the Cheetah is a significant element. Her transformation not only adds a new antagonist but also shows the dark side of wishes. Diana's own wish for Steve Trevor's return is a key emotional and plot - driving factor. It shows her human side and also creates complex situations. Moreover, Diana's fight to save the world from the destruction caused by these wishes is at the heart of the story.
